What is Baahubali 2: The Conclusion about?
Amarendra Baahubali’s son Mahendra fights to reclaim the throne of Mahishmati and avenge the betrayal that destroyed his family.
Rajamouli’s conclusion delivered record-breaking spectacle and cemented pan-Indian event filmmaking. The film stars Prabhas, Rana Daggubati, Anushka Shetty. S. S. Why did Baahubali 2 redefine Indian spectacle?
Rajamouli answered every question the first film raised — and staged a war sequence that made Indian VFX a global talking point. Prabhas, Rana Daggubati, and Anushka Shetty play mythic royalty with straight faces while the plot delivers palace betrayals, waterfall births, and a statue-lifting climax that must be seen on the largest screen available.
Who should watch Baahubali 2?
Watch Baahubali: The Beginning first, then expect a 167-minute conclusion that rewards patience with pure cinematic adrenaline. Fantasy and action fans who tolerated Lord of the Rings length will feel at home.
